Additional Certifications or Qualifications to Pursue Alongside RQF Extended Diploma in Health Social Care Management (Fast Track)

Congratulations on pursuing the RQF Extended Diploma in Health Social Care Management (Fast Track)! This qualification is a great stepping stone towards a successful career in the healthcare industry. However, if you are looking to enhance your skills and knowledge further, there are several additional certifications and qualifications you can pursue alongside your diploma. Here are some popular options to consider:

Certification/Qualification Description
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) This certification provides hands-on training in basic patient care, vital signs monitoring, and communication skills, making it a valuable addition to your diploma.
First Aid/CPR Certification Having a valid First Aid and CPR certification is essential for healthcare professionals as it equips you with life-saving skills in emergency situations.
Mental Health First Aid Certification This certification focuses on providing support to individuals experiencing mental health crises, enhancing your ability to address mental health issues in your role.
Healthcare Management Certification A certification in healthcare management will equip you with the skills needed to effectively manage healthcare facilities and teams, complementing your diploma in Health Social Care Management.

These additional certifications and qualifications will not only enhance your resume but also broaden your skill set, making you a more competitive candidate in the healthcare industry. Remember to research each certification thoroughly to ensure it aligns with your career goals and interests.
